First Stop: Mandarin House

Located conveniently on Forsyth Boulevard, Mandarin House offers a classic American-Chinese dining experience. From the moment you step inside, you’re greeted with a warm and inviting atmosphere, complete with traditional décor and attentive service. Mandarin House is a Clayton institution, having served generations of locals with their comforting and familiar dishes. The price point is reasonable, making it an accessible option for lunch or dinner.

What truly sets Mandarin House apart are its signature dishes. The General Tso’s Chicken is a perennial favorite, offering the perfect balance of sweet, savory, and spicy. The crispy coating gives way to tender chicken, all bathed in a flavorful sauce that keeps you coming back for more. The restaurant’s egg rolls are also noteworthy, packed with fresh vegetables and perfectly fried to a golden crisp. And if you’re looking for a more traditional option, their Moo Goo Gai Pan is a light and flavorful dish, showcasing the freshness of the ingredients.

Mandarin House excels at providing a consistent and reliable dining experience. The service is always friendly and efficient, and the food is consistently good. However, it’s important to note that it can get quite busy during peak hours, especially on weekends. Parking can also be a bit of a challenge. This restaurant is perfect for a casual lunch with colleagues, a family dinner, or a quick takeout order on a busy weeknight. Authentic Delights at Sichuan House

For those seeking a more authentic and fiery culinary adventure, Sichuan House presents a tantalizing alternative. Located just a short drive from Clayton, this restaurant specializes in the bold and spicy flavors of Sichuan cuisine. The ambiance is modern and vibrant, reflecting the energy of the dishes. Be prepared for a symphony of sensations as your taste buds encounter the region’s signature peppercorns, chili oils, and fermented ingredients.

Sichuan House’s menu is extensive, offering a wide array of dishes that showcase the depth and complexity of Sichuan cooking. One dish that truly stands out is the Mapo Tofu, a deceptively simple dish that packs a powerful punch. The silky tofu is simmered in a rich and spicy sauce, infused with fermented black beans and ground meat (optional). The result is a harmonious blend of textures and flavors that is both comforting and exhilarating. The Dan Dan Noodles are another must-try, featuring chewy noodles tossed in a sesame-peanut sauce, topped with spicy chili oil and preserved vegetables. And for the adventurous palate, the Twice Cooked Pork is a classic Sichuan dish that is not to be missed.

Sichuan House is a great place to expand your culinary horizons and experience the true taste of Sichuan cuisine. The portions are generous, and the prices are reasonable. However, be warned that the spice levels can be quite intense, so be sure to communicate your preferences to your server. Popular Dishes Explained

For those unfamiliar with the intricacies of Chinese cuisine, here’s a brief overview of some popular dishes:

Kung Pao Chicken: A classic dish from Sichuan province, featuring diced chicken, peanuts, vegetables, and a spicy chili sauce.

Mapo Tofu: A spicy and flavorful tofu dish, originating from Sichuan province.

Peking Duck: A roasted duck dish with crispy skin, traditionally served with thin pancakes, scallions, and hoisin sauce.

Dim Sum: A Cantonese cuisine involving a wide range of small, steamed, fried, or baked dishes served with tea.

Tips for Enjoying Chinese Food to the Fullest

Navigating a Chinese menu can sometimes feel daunting, but with a few simple tips, you can confidently order dishes that you’ll love. Start by exploring the different regional cuisines of China, such as Sichuan, Cantonese, and Hunan, and identify the flavors that appeal to you. Don’t be afraid to ask your server for recommendations or explanations of unfamiliar dishes. When ordering for a group, aim for a variety of dishes to share, ensuring a balanced mix of flavors and textures. And if you have dietary restrictions, such as vegetarian or gluten-free, be sure to inform your server, as many Chinese restaurants are happy to accommodate special requests. Spiciness is a prominent feature of some of the cuisine, so don’t be afraid to request dishes to be mild or extra spicy based on your preferences.
